当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

分布式对象存储的概念及原理,深入解析分布式对象存储,概念、原理及优势分析

分布式对象存储的概念及原理,深入解析分布式对象存储,概念、原理及优势分析

分布式对象存储通过将数据分散存储在多个节点上,实现数据的高可用性和高性能。其原理包括数据分割、节点通信和一致性保证。分析显示,分布式对象存储具有高可靠性、扩展性和高效性...

分布式对象存储通过将数据分散存储在多个节点上,实现数据的高可用性和高性能。其原理包括数据分割、节点通信和一致性保证。分析显示,分布式对象存储具有高可靠性、扩展性和高效性等优势。

分布式对象存储概念

分布式对象存储是一种基于分布式存储架构的对象存储技术,它将数据以对象的形式存储在多个节点上,通过分布式文件系统(DFS)实现数据的分散存储、高效访问和可靠保护,分布式对象存储将数据对象与其元数据分离,提供统一的数据访问接口,具有高可用性、高可靠性和高扩展性等特点。

分布式对象存储的概念及原理,深入解析分布式对象存储,概念、原理及优势分析

分布式对象存储原理

1、数据对象与元数据分离

在分布式对象存储中,数据对象与其元数据被分离存储,数据对象是指存储在分布式存储系统中的实际数据,如图片、视频、文档等;元数据是指描述数据对象属性的信息,如文件名、大小、创建时间、访问权限等,将数据对象与元数据分离,有助于提高数据访问效率、降低存储成本。

2、分布式文件系统(DFS)

分布式对象存储采用分布式文件系统(DFS)实现数据的分散存储,DFS将存储节点划分为多个文件系统,每个文件系统负责存储一部分数据,DFS通过数据副本机制,保证数据的高可用性和可靠性,DFS采用一致性算法,确保分布式存储系统中的数据一致性和可靠性。

3、负载均衡

分布式对象存储采用负载均衡技术,将数据请求分配到合适的存储节点,负载均衡算法根据节点性能、网络延迟等因素,动态调整数据请求的分配策略,确保系统资源得到充分利用,提高系统性能。

4、数据访问接口

分布式对象存储提供统一的数据访问接口,支持多种编程语言和开发框架,用户可以通过简单的API调用,实现对存储数据的访问、修改、删除等操作,数据访问接口通常包括以下功能:

分布式对象存储的概念及原理,深入解析分布式对象存储,概念、原理及优势分析

(1)对象存储:将数据对象存储到分布式存储系统中;

(2)对象检索:根据对象名称、标签、属性等条件,检索存储在分布式存储系统中的数据对象;

(3)对象修改:修改存储在分布式存储系统中的数据对象属性;

(4)对象删除:删除存储在分布式存储系统中的数据对象。

分布式对象存储优势

1、高可用性

分布式对象存储采用数据副本机制,将数据存储在多个节点上,即使某个节点出现故障,也不会影响数据的访问和可靠性,分布式对象存储系统通常具备自动故障转移功能,确保系统在故障情况下快速恢复。

2、高可靠性

分布式对象存储采用一致性算法,保证分布式存储系统中的数据一致性和可靠性,数据备份和容灾机制确保数据的安全性和完整性。

分布式对象存储的概念及原理,深入解析分布式对象存储,概念、原理及优势分析

3、高扩展性

分布式对象存储采用水平扩展方式,通过增加存储节点来提高存储容量和性能,这种扩展方式使得分布式对象存储系统具有极高的扩展性,能够满足不断增长的数据存储需求。

4、良好的性能

分布式对象存储采用负载均衡技术,将数据请求分配到合适的存储节点,提高系统性能,分布式对象存储系统通常采用SSD等高性能存储设备,进一步提升了数据访问速度。

5、统一的数据访问接口

分布式对象存储提供统一的数据访问接口,支持多种编程语言和开发框架,方便用户进行数据存储和访问。

分布式对象存储是一种高效、可靠、可扩展的存储技术,具有诸多优势,随着大数据时代的到来,分布式对象存储在各个领域得到广泛应用,了解分布式对象存储的概念、原理和优势,有助于我们更好地利用这一技术,解决数据存储和访问的难题。

黑狐家游戏

发表评论

最新文章